Myanma Railways has started new passenger train services using a battery electric locomotive (BEL) and an RBE train on the Mandalay–Lashio railway line. From December 19, the Zeebinkyi–Pyin Oo Lwin–Zeebinkyi route is operating with a battery electric locomotive, while the Pyin Oo Lwin–Gokteik–Pyin Oo Lwin route is running with an RBE train.

These services will operate every Saturday and Sunday. The BEL train departs Zibinkyi in the morning and reaches Pyin Oo Lwin, where passengers can continue their journey to Gokteik by RBE train. After reaching Gokteik, the RBE train returns to Pyin Oo Lwin, and passengers can then continue back to Zeebinkyi by BEL train.

Ticket prices for the Zeebinkyi–Pyin Oo Lwin route are 5,000 kyats for ordinary class and 10,000 kyats for upper class. The round-trip fare for the Pyin Oo Lwin–Gokteik–Pyin Oo Lwin RBE journey is 15,000 kyats per passenger. The new services aim to improve public transportation and allow passengers to enjoy scenic views along the railway route.
